Output 891ca726321d19a22ede79bbe5c78eb5bdf313df8b2548161ad7a95baf8edda1:0

value
3865404
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 865e8a6691787657fd8f6cd4086ee983292711ed OP_EQUALVERIFY OP_CHECKSIG
address
1DFUoWBtqwUr7SFHaGKJrTsm6yu8osXX4j
transaction
891ca726321d19a22ede79bbe5c78eb5bdf313df8b2548161ad7a95baf8edda1
spent
true